What is first Indian spaceship to hit moon?
The first Indian spacecraft to successfully reach the Moon is Chandrayaan-1, which was launched by the Indian Space Research Organisation (ISRO) on October 22, 2008. It entered lunar orbit on November 8, 2008, and made significant contributions to lunar science, including the discovery of water molecules on the Moon's surface. Chandrayaan-1 marked a major milestone for India in space exploration.

What is the Moon's surface composed of?
The Moon's surface is primarily composed of a type of rock known as basalt, which is formed from volcanic activity, and anorthosite, a lighter rock made up of plagioclase feldspar. The surface is also covered with a layer of regolith, a fine dust and rocky debris created by the constant impact of meteoroids. Additionally, there are various minerals present, including ilmenite, pyroxene, and olivine. The lack of atmosphere on the Moon contributes to its rugged and heavily cratered landscape.

What is the largest crater on the moon named?
The largest crater on the Moon is called the South Pole-Aitken Basin. It measures approximately 2,500 kilometers (about 1,550 miles) in diameter and is over 13 kilometers (8 miles) deep. This immense impact feature is located on the far side of the Moon and is one of the largest known impact craters in the solar system. Its size and depth make it a significant area of interest for scientific research.

How does the moon float on space?
The Moon "floats" in space due to the balance between its inertia and the gravitational pull from the Earth. As it travels in its orbit, the Moon moves forward at a high speed while simultaneously being pulled towards the Earth by gravity. This creates a stable orbit, preventing it from falling into the Earth or drifting away into space. Essentially, the Moon is in free fall, continuously falling towards the Earth while moving forward, resulting in its orbital path.

As the moon orbits earth what appears to be changing?
As the Moon orbits Earth, its appearance changes due to the varying angles of sunlight that illuminate it, resulting in different phases. These phases cycle through new moon, crescent, first quarter, gibbous, and full moon over approximately 29.5 days. This phenomenon occurs because we see different portions of the Moon's surface lit by the Sun while it orbits our planet.

Can we hear the sound on the moon?
No, we cannot hear sound on the Moon because sound requires a medium, like air, to travel through. The Moon has no atmosphere, which means there are no air molecules to carry sound waves. Consequently, any sounds produced on the Moon would not be audible to human ears.

How large is the moon exactly?
The Moon has a diameter of about 3,474 kilometers (2,159 miles), making it approximately one-quarter the size of Earth. Its surface area is roughly 37.9 million square kilometers (14.6 million square miles), which is about 7.4% of Earth's total surface area. The Moon's volume is about 2.2 billion cubic kilometers (0.53 billion cubic miles).
How do scientists know the composition of the moon?
Scientists determine the composition of the Moon through various methods, including analysis of lunar samples brought back by the Apollo missions, remote sensing from orbiting spacecraft, and spectral analysis of lunar surface materials. Instruments like X-ray fluorescence and neutron spectroscopy help identify the elemental makeup of the Moon's surface. Additionally, data from lunar missions like India's Chandrayaan and Japan's SELENE have provided further insights into the Moon's mineralogy and geochemistry. These combined efforts enable a comprehensive understanding of the Moon's composition.
